Specifications
ADI Part Number P9-SSMF399 Brand Name Panduit Manufacturer PANDUIT CORP Manufacturer Part Number FZ2ERLNSNSNM018 Product Name Fiber Optic Duplex Patch Network Cable Product Type Network Cable
Cable Type Fiber Optic Core/Cladding Diameter 50/125 µm Device Supported Network Device Fiber Category OM4 Fiber Optic Mode Multimode
Data Transfer Rate 10 Gbit/s
Cable Length 59'
Limited Warranty 1-Year
Environmentally Friendly Yes
